Lost in Space

Album: not released on an album (2011)
Play Video

Songfacts®:

  • This Electro-Pop song utilizes a zero gravity theme as a metaphor for how the boys feel about their girl - "How did we get here, it feels like I'm fallin' off the ground, love is the only place, now I'm getting scared of looking down."
  • The song was produced by Jim Jonsin, whose previous credits include chart toppers by Lil Wayne ("Lollipop") and T.I. ("Whatever You Like").
